WebThere is no elementary function whose derivative is e − x 2. By elementary function we mean something obtained using arithmetical operations and composition from the standard functions we all know and love. But this is not a serious problem. A few important definite integrals involving e − x 2 have pleasant closed form. – André Nicolas
